  • Despite their many advantages, twin stitch needles do require some practice to use effectively. Sewing with twin stitch needles can be more challenging than using a single needle, as you have to align the fabric correctly to create two parallel rows of stitching. Additionally, twin stitch needles are not suitable for all types of sewing projects, such as intricate embroidery or delicate fabrics. However, with practice and patience, most sewers find that twin stitch needles are a valuable tool in their sewing arsenal.

  • The Silai machine, derived from the Hindi word 'Silai,' which means stitching, is a simple sewing device that has been in use for decades. Traditionally, these machines were manually operated, requiring considerable physical effort to operate. However, the introduction of electric-powered Silai machines has revolutionized this age-old craft, bringing about a paradigm shift in the way clothes are sewn and garments are produced.
